The rise of digital transformation has fundamentally changed how businesses operate, sell, and interact with customers. eCommerce is no longer limited to simple online stores—it has evolved into a complex ecosystem driven by data, automation, and user experience.
At the center of this transformation are two major business models: B2B (Business-to-Business) and B2C (Business-to-Consumer) eCommerce.
While both involve selling products or services online, their development strategies, features, and user expectations are vastly different. Understanding these differences is essential for businesses looking to build scalable, efficient, and customer-centric platforms.
In this guide, we’ll explore the key differences between B2B and B2C eCommerce development and how digital transformation is shaping both.
B2B eCommerce involves transactions between businesses. For example, wholesalers selling to retailers or manufacturers supplying distributors.
B2C eCommerce focuses on selling directly to end consumers, such as online retail stores.
Although both models use digital platforms, their goals, processes, and user journeys differ significantly.
Digital transformation has revolutionized eCommerce by introducing:
AI-driven personalization
Automation and workflow management
Cloud-based platforms
Data analytics and insights
Omnichannel customer experiences
These advancements allow businesses to deliver faster, smarter, and more personalized services—whether they operate in B2B or B2C markets.
B2B:
Businesses, procurement teams, and decision-makers
Focus on long-term relationships
B2C:
Individual consumers
Focus on quick purchases and emotional engagement
Impact on development:
B2B platforms require detailed product information and negotiation features, while B2C platforms prioritize simplicity and speed.
B2B:
Longer sales cycles
Multiple stakeholders
Negotiations and approvals
B2C:
Short and straightforward
Single decision-maker
Instant checkout
Digital transformation impact:
Automation tools streamline complex B2B workflows, while B2C platforms use one-click checkout and AI recommendations.
B2B:
Custom pricing
Bulk discounts
Contract-based rates
B2C:
Fixed pricing
Occasional discounts and promotions
Development requirement:
B2B systems must support dynamic pricing and customer-specific catalogs, whereas B2C focuses on transparent pricing.
B2B:
Functional and information-driven
Advanced search and filtering
B2C:
Visually appealing and engaging
Easy navigation and quick checkout
Digital transformation role:
AI enhances UX in both models—personalized dashboards for B2B and tailored product recommendations for B2C.
B2B:
Purchase orders
Net payment terms (e.g., Net 30, Net 60)
Bank transfers
B2C:
Credit/debit cards
Digital wallets
Instant payments
Development need:
B2B platforms require flexible payment options and credit management systems.
B2B:
Large bulk orders
Complex logistics
B2C:
Smaller orders
Simpler fulfillment
Impact:
B2B systems need robust inventory and supply chain integration, while B2C focuses on fast delivery and tracking.
B2B:
Account-based personalization
Custom dashboards
B2C:
Behavioral personalization
Product recommendations
Digital transformation advantage:
Data analytics enables both models to deliver highly targeted experiences.
B2B:
Email marketing
LinkedIn campaigns
Relationship-driven sales
B2C:
Social media marketing
Influencer collaborations
Paid ads
Technology impact:
Marketing automation tools help businesses run targeted campaigns efficiently.
B2B:
ERP systems
CRM platforms
Supply chain tools
B2C:
Payment gateways
Shipping providers
Marketing tools
Development focus:
B2B requires deeper backend integration compared to B2C.
Despite their differences, both models share common goals:
Deliver seamless user experiences
Ensure data security
Optimize performance and scalability
Leverage analytics for decision-making
Both rely heavily on digital transformation to stay competitive.
To decide between B2B and B2C (or a hybrid model), businesses should consider:
Target audience
Product type
Sales cycle complexity
Budget and scalability needs
Some businesses adopt B2B2C models, combining both approaches to maximize reach.
Digital transformation continues to shape the future of eCommerce.
AI-powered chatbots and assistants
Voice commerce
Headless commerce architecture
Augmented reality (AR) shopping
Blockchain for secure transactions
Businesses that embrace these innovations will gain a competitive edge.
B2B and B2C eCommerce may operate in the same digital space, but their development strategies are fundamentally different. From user experience to pricing and integrations, each model requires a tailored approach.
Digital transformation has made it possible to build smarter, more efficient platforms that meet the unique needs of each business model. By understanding these differences, businesses can make informed decisions and create platforms that drive growth, engagement, and long-term success.
In today’s competitive market, success in eCommerce depends not just on selling online—but on building the right digital experience for your audience.
Looking to develop a scalable and high-performing eCommerce platform?
Zorbis specializes in building customized B2B and B2C eCommerce solutions powered by cutting-edge technology and digital transformation strategies.
Partner with Zorbis today to create secure, scalable, and future-ready eCommerce platforms that drive real business growth.